Mortgage applications on the rise again
Mortgage applications jumped 8.15% from the week ending Jan. 29, breaking a two-week streak of decreases, per MBA reports. The refinance index and purchase index all saw increases, as well.

Forbearance rate left unchanged as exits slow
The U.S. forbearance rate remained unchanged from the week prior at 5.38%, according to a survey from the Mortgage Bankers Association on Monday.
